Lee Evans To Ravens

Lee Evans Trade Could Be Completed This Weekend: Bills trade WR Lee Evans to Ravens: The Ravens imported more experience at the position Friday, acquiring Lee Evans from the Bills.

He offered an upfront view of his talents last October, burning the Ravens for 105 yards (on six catches) and three TDs in Baltimore.

"He's a quality veteran receiver who stretches the field and gives us a significant downfield presence," Ravens GM Ozzie Newsome said in a statement. "He's the type of person you want on your team. He brings leadership and maturity to the locker room.

"He's a proven player in this league and a quality person who will fit in well on our team," said Baltimore coach John Harbaugh. "We're all looking forward to going to work with him."

Evans' departure leaves Stevie Johnson as the clear-cut No. 1 wideout in Buffalo and opens up a starting spot for Marcus Easley, David Nelson, Roscoe Parrish or Brad Smith.

Per ESPN, the Ravens gave up a 2012 fourth-round pick for Evans. By Usatoday
